logo

Output e902466fb6d32cc17c93bef7157b32963c1bb46721e4669d19f07bd8a3da144f:0

value
660380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38d2c85e49cd0febe06fb9e817d49e085acebb97 OP_EQUALVERIFY OP_CHECKSIG
address
16BTMBU6TAfBokAevEomXGDJbxAiJCsCvt
transaction
e902466fb6d32cc17c93bef7157b32963c1bb46721e4669d19f07bd8a3da144f